Ok. So I am going to do this and write you what happens at the same time.
I deleted profiles folder started PRBF2.exe.
I checked and now in documents\projectreality\profiles\
default directory I have 3 files profile.con, video.con and audio.con
Now I retrieved my account and when I pressed "Retrieve" I got a critical error
Code: Select all
Project Reality Log File
PRLauncher.exe started at: 2015-08-04T19:53:06
Critical Error: An unhandled exception has occured. Details are as follows:
Object reference not set to an instance of an object.
Further details can be found in the following file:
[url]D:\Project Reality\Project Reality BF2\mods\pr\bin\PRLauncher.log[/url]
Please report this error to the Project Reality Team, and include the log file in your report.
[url=https://www.realitymod.com/forum/f27-pr-bf2-support]Visit Support Forum[/url]
> System.NullReferenceException: Object reference not set to an instance of an object.
at Va.h.a()
at Reality.BF2.Settings.Video.a(String a)
at System.Linq.Enumerable.WhereEnumerableIterator`1.MoveNext()
at System.Linq.Enumerable.FirstOrDefault[TSource](IEnumerable`1 source)
at Reality.BF2.Settings.Video.GetDefaultResolution()
at Reality.BF2.Settings.Video.CreateDefault(UInt16 a)
at Reality.BF2.Settings.Profile.CreateNewProfile(UInt16 a)
at PRLauncher.WPF.ViewModel.Pages.FirstTimeRetrieveAccountPageViewModel.b.a.a(Object a, GameSpyRetrieveSuccessEventArgs b)
at Reality.BF2.GameSpy.GameSpyConnection.a(GameSpyRetrieveSuccessEventArgs a)
at Reality.BF2.GameSpy.GameSpyConnection.a.a(Object a, RealitySocketReceivedDataEventArgs b)
at Reality.Net.RealitySocket.a(RealitySocketReceivedDataEventArgs a)
at Reality.Net.RealitySocket.b(IAsyncResult a)
at System.Net.LazyAsyncResult.Complete(IntPtr userToken)
at System.Threading.ExecutionContext.RunInternal(ExecutionContext executionContext, ContextCallback callback, Object state, Boolean preserveSyncCtx)
at System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state, Boolean preserveSyncCtx)
at System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state)
at System.Net.ContextAwareResult.Complete(IntPtr userToken)
at System.Net.Sockets.BaseOverlappedAsyncResult.CompletionPortCallback(UInt32 errorCode, UInt32 numBytes, NativeOverlapped* nativeOverlapped)
at System.Threading._IOCompletionCallback.PerformIOCompletionCallback(UInt32 errorCode, UInt32 numBytes, NativeOverlapped* pOVERLAP)
So I run the launcher again and my profile is retrieved so I log into it and a window comes up saying Launching PRBF2 and after some time loading an error occurs
1324: The selected display mode is not supported.Please update the display mode for your profile in the "Options" menu and try again.
So I update it in the settings press apply then close and log in and bam the same error occurs and in settings the display mode is again blank.
I go in the documents\projectreality\profiles\0001 and I only have profiles.con file (no video.con or audio.con). So I came up with the idea to copy video.con and audio.con from documents\projectreality\profiles\default and then try. I logged in and right when the game started I got a error (not a critical)
1103: There was an error linking to the game process. Please try again.
While I was writing this and that error still opened, another ,this time, critical error appeared
Code: Select all
Project Reality Log File
PRLauncher.exe started at: 2015-08-04T20:00:56
Warning: Error in game thread: 3
> Could not find file 'C:\Users\PC\Documents\ProjectReality\Profiles\0001\Controls.con'.
Error: 1103: There was an error linking to the game process. Please try again.
Critical Error: An unhandled exception has occured. Details are as follows:
No process is associated with this object.
Further details can be found in the following file:
[url]D:\Project Reality\Project Reality BF2\mods\pr\bin\PRLauncher.log[/url]
Please report this error to the Project Reality Team, and include the log file in your report.
[url=https://www.realitymod.com/forum/f27-pr-bf2-support]Visit Support Forum[/url]
> System.InvalidOperationException: No process is associated with this object.
at System.Diagnostics.Process.EnsureState(State state)
at System.Diagnostics.Process.get_HasExited()
at Reality.BF2.Game.WhileRunning.b.d()
at System.Threading.ExecutionContext.RunInternal(ExecutionContext executionContext, ContextCallback callback, Object state, Boolean preserveSyncCtx)
at System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state, Boolean preserveSyncCtx)
at System.Threading.ExecutionContext.Run(ExecutionContext executionContext, ContextCallback callback, Object state)
at System.Threading.ThreadHelper.ThreadStart()
I don't know how to post a screenshot here (On my first post I couldn't see the picture) but you'll have to believe that my drivers are up to date in geforce experience app (one reason for that to be blank is maybe because I do have the newest driver which has support for Windows 10 which I don't have yet) but I play a LOT other games without any problem.